Soy Bean Powder: Overview

Soybean powder is a nutritious and versatile product made from ground soybeans, a legume that's been cultivated for centuries and is renowned for its exceptional nutritional value. Soybeans are packed with protein, healthy fats, d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als, making soybean powder a valuable addition to various diets.

Soybean powder is a rich source of high-quality plant-based protein, containing all essential amino acids required by the human body. It is also a significant source of unsaturated fats, including om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ids, which are beneficial for heart health. Additionally, soybean powder is abundant in vitamins and minerals, such as folate, potassium, and magnesium.

This versatile powder can be incorporated into a wide range of recipes, including smoothies, baked goods, and soups, to boost their nutritional content. It is a particularly popular choice among vegetarians and vegans due to its protein content and versatility in plant-based cooking.
